Gamma extends the factorial

Γ(n) = (n−1)! for positive integers, but gamma is defined for all real and complex arguments except zero and the negative integers, where it has poles. Γ(½) = √π is the famous non-integer value.

The error function

erf is the integral of the Gaussian, scaled so that it runs from −1 to 1. It is how the normal distribution’s cumulative probability is actually computed, since that integral has no elementary form.
